Technical Deep Dive (1/3 Article Focus): Our sensors use vibration analysis (FFT spectrum up to 10kHz) for early wear detection in ball screws, where RMS velocity thresholds (<0.5 mm/s) flag anomalies. Temperature monitoring employs Kalman filtering for noise reduction, achieving 0.2°C resolution. Predictive models, powered by edge AI, analyze machine health indicators like kurtosis and crest factor, predicting failures with 95% precision based on 50,000+ hours of field data. For linear guides, load cells measure dynamic forces with 1kHz sampling, integrating with IoT condition monitoring platforms for dashboards showing trend graphs and alerts. Ball splines benefit from acoustic emission sensors detecting micro-cracks at 40dB sensitivity. This setup complies with US standards (FCC, RoHS), ensuring seamless deployment in automotive, aerospace, and CNC applications.
